Position Summary:
Under the direction of the Home Care Resource Coordinator, the Home Care Attendant (HCA) functions as a member of the Home Care team and is responsible for the provision of personal care and home support services to an
individual or group of home care clients as assigned. As identified by an established plan of care, the HCA provides paraprofessional services to assist frail, physically disabled, and/or mentally challenged clients of all ages to remain in their own
homes as long as safely possible.
The incumbent will exercise the appropriate level of initiative and independent judgment in determining work priorities, work methods to be employed and action to be taken on unusual matters.

Qualifications:
- Grade 12 education required
- Home Care Attendant Certificate or Health Care Aide Certificate with community component from a recognized postsecondary institute
- Knowledge of Safe Food Handling
- Previous experience working with the elderly or disabled in a community setting is preferred
- Previous experience working in a home care program is an asset
- Demonstrated ability to work independently and as a team member
- Given the cultural diversity of our region, the ability to respect and promote a culturally diverse population is required
- Proficiency of both official languages is essential for target and designated bilingual positions
- Demonstrated ability to respect confidentiality including paper, electronic formats and other mediums
- Demonstrated ability to meet the physical and mental demands of the job
- Good work and attendance record
Conditions of Employment:
- Completes and maintains a satisfactory Criminal Record Check, Vulnerable Sector Search, Adult Abuse Registry Check and Child Abuse Registry Check, as appropriate.
- All Health Care workers are required to be immunized as a condition of employment in accordance with Southern Health-Santé Sud policy.
- Requires a valid Class 5 driver's license, an allpurpose insured vehicle and liability insurance of at least $1,000,000.00.
